The time right now is gone 2am, we've not had very much sleep in a while and a couple of hours ago we were tipped off that the Opera Wii Browser was available to download. Instantly we raced downstairs, waited about five minutes for the ruddy thing to download and we've spent the last two hours playing about with it like over-excited kids at Christmas. Yup, Santa came early for the Wii world as Nintendo delivered a full working BETA version of the Opera Wii Browser for free. We plonked our camera down in front of it and now we can bring you an extensive video report on all it has to offer.
